Web Design: A Introductory Guide

So, you want to understand the core concepts of web design? Fantastic! It’s a exciting field with lots of opportunities . This concise guide introduces the key elements. First, you’ll have to get acquainted with HTML, the language that forms the content of a site . Then, master CSS, which handles the design. Lastly , consider scripting for engaging elements – although that’s a more advanced topic to explore later. Here's a quick summary:

  • {HTML: The content structure of your online presence
  • {CSS: Styling and aesthetics
  • {JavaScript: Adding interactivity and responsive behavior

Building your Online Presence: DIY vs. Expert Help

Choosing if to build your own website can be a difficult matter. DIY website builders offer fantastic ease and cost savings , allowing users to manage of their online presence. Nevertheless , these choices sometimes require a significant time investment and may not include the polish requested by businesses . Alternatively , hiring professional website designer guarantees a polished outcome but involves a greater financial investment .

  • Benefits of DIY: Affordable options, direct oversight, quicker setup
  • Limitations of DIY: Steep learning curve , fewer customization options, risk of mistakes
  • Benefits of Professional Help: Specialized skills, Streamlined process, Modern features
  • Considerations with Professionals: Higher cost , Potential for delays, Communication challenges
